Bending Elevator Tabs |
|
|
Started off by cleco'ing together the underlying structure and the skins. Then measured out the fit of the two tabs that close off the elevator opposite the trim tab. I started the bending by using a hand seamer, then pushed them almost closed with a large block of wood. Once the tabs were almost closed, I used a rivet gun with the large round flat rivet shank to hammer them into position. It worked very well. :-) The nail in the picture was a tack I drove into the wood to allow me to position it before starting. I will save the block for the other end of the trim tab. |
